A talented Senior Web Analyst is required by an expanding on-line business. Reporting into the Head of E-commerce the Senior Web Analyst will be managing key projects and driving conversion rates for marketing as well as increasing traffic to the websites.

What do you need?

  • Min 3 years' experience in driving data strategy and attribution modelling across multiple sources (websites, apps, marketing channels, surveys, usability testing, CRM systems, focus groups etc.).
  • Min 3 years' experience using:
    • Attribution reporting tools such as Google Analytics or similar web analytics tools such as Adobe (Omniture), Coremetrics etc.
    • Google Tag Manager – both using the tools and understanding the tagging and tracking of campaigns.
    • Microsoft Office suite with advanced Excel skills.
  • Experience using the following would be advantageous:
    • Power BI or similar data visualisation tools.
    • Convert or similar A/B testing tool such as Optimisely.
    • Business Intelligence tools such as Business Objects, MicroStrategy, Cognos, Brio.
    • App Analytics software such as Appsflyer, AppsAnnie or similar.
  • Educated to degree level or able to demonstrate equivalent experience.
  • Ideally you will have experience within an e-commerce or on-line retail environment.

What does the job involve?

A variety of duties and projects will be on offer and will include:

  • Support to the digital marketing team on scoping and executing pieces of analysis and reporting including activities including:
    • Campaign analysis, reporting on PPC, SEO, display and social media channels
    • Web performance insight
    • Analysis on customer behaviour, touch points and customer retention rates
  • Pull together raw data from different sources to create dashboards and reports for presentations
  • Design and analyse AB / MVT tests, and recommend improvements.
  • Provide business intelligence to inform the management team of strategies across the business including websites, apps and marketing channels for both B2C and B2B products
